I am pretty positive that it isn't quite as easy as just slapping on some hubs and brakes from an evo. Yeah evo hubs could possibly work put I certainly wouldn't get my hopes up and the brakes would be a hell of an issue and would probably take some welding and engineering. If you want big brakes RMR has some wilwoods or I am sure RPW could find some and I know RPW can get a rear disc conversion b/c I have ordered one from them. Contact vision imports (www.visionimports.com) for all of your RPW inquiries. If you haven't done a lot of mods all you would really need are some decent pads. Get slotted rotors, SS lines, and maybe even some better brake fluid if you plan on seeing any kind of heat in your brakes.
